POP email Problem...

I set up my charter pop mail on my TP today.. it retrieved mail no problem on the initial setup. I then go to check for new mail which I know is there cause i sent it.. It will connect... check for changes .. Logging on then finish with no new mail..

It also sometimes will say can not download messages.


I have deleted the account and set up twice now with the same results.

Re: POP email Problem...

Just going to throw out the obvious out here....but....if you can retrieve mail without issues but not send outgoing mail, make sure your SMTP settings are correct in your settings. In addition, if your mail account requires an SSL connection or requires seperate authentication settings make sure those are set too.

Just something to check.

Re: POP email Problem...

Just checked , try to put your user name under this exact format:
recent:name@gmail.com
